Tampa FDLE Agent OK After Getting Shot in Kissimmee

KISSIMMEE -- A Florida Department of Law Enforcement agent based out of Tampa is likely to leave the hospital after getting shot during a shooting between law enforcement officers and suspects in a drug investigation spanning several agencies.

According to a statement, agents from the Tampa Bay Regional Operations Center were assisting agents in the Orlando area around 3 Tuesday afternoon, following suspects in an unmarked vehicle on Hoagland Boulevard, when it is believed, the suspects began shooting at the agents. They returned fire.

The suspect was shot and as of Tuesday evening was in critical condition at Osceola Regional Medical Center.

Kissimmee Police are investigating the shooting.
